Mineral: Smithsonite on Sphalerite

Locality: Tsumeb Mine, Tsumeb, Oshikoto Region, Namibia

Description: The most famous locality in the world for smithsonite is certainly the Tsumeb mine. Smithsonite was found in abundance in a variety of habits and colors at the mine while it was producing. Perhaps one of the best known varieties of smithsonite was the cobaltoan pink. This particular specimen features a fantastic intensity of bright pink color. Please also note that the matrix is comprised primarily of sphalerite and fluoresces a lovely bright orange under a LW UV light.
